Comment 1 Mark Purtill 2004-04-03 17:26:43 UTC
I re-emerged xine and removed my ~/.xine directory as the ebuild suggested.  (This message, of course, isn't very helpful when it's in the middle of a big "emerge world", but probably I should have done that in the first place.)  Things now seem to work except I get no sound (but that would be a different bug if I can't figure it out).  Marking this as INVALID.
